Climate Change (Emissions Reduction Targets) (Scotland) Bill: Timetable for Consideration

  • Submitted by: Jamie Hepburn, Cumbernauld and Kilsyth, Scottish National Party.
  • Date lodged: Tuesday, 24 September 2024
  • Motion reference: S6M-14652
  • Current status: Taken in the Chamber on Wednesday, 25 September 2024

That the Parliament agrees to consider the Climate Change (Emissions Reduction Targets) (Scotland) Bill as follows—

Stage 1 on Thursday 10 October 2024, and subject to the Parliament’s agreement to the general principles of the Bill—

(a) that consideration of the Bill at stage 2 be completed by Tuesday 29 October 2024, and

(b) Stage 3 on Thursday 31 October 2024.


Vote

Result 60 for, 61 against, 0 abstained, 8 did not vote Vote Defeated
